A global data center operator based in the UK seeks an experienced leader for its Design Management team in the EMEA region. This role requires at least 15 years of experience in managed building design, with thorough knowledge of data center infrastructure.
The successful candidate will oversee design processes, ensure contractor performance, and manage commercial aspects of projects while fostering inclusive practices. The position offers a chance to make a significant impact in a fast-paced environment.
